Step #1: Make Your Solution

The first step in caring for your steel entry door is by making your solution. To do this, simply mix a teaspoon of mild dishwashing soap into two cups of warm water before pouring it into a spray bottle. On the other hand, if your door has tougher stains, experts recommend that you use trisodium phosphate, an all-purpose cleaner that doesn’t harm most surfaces.

Step #2: Cleaning Process

Once you’ve created the solution, you can now start the cleaning process of your new entry doors. Place an old towel, rags or layers of newspaper at the bottom of the door to catch drips from the solution before spraying your mixture on the surface of the door and allowing the spray to run down. When spraying, make sure you’re as thorough as possible. Once you’re done, wipe the door with a rag to remove the grease, dirt and grime and repeat the process until your door is completely clean.

Step #3: Rinsing and Drying

After you’ve thoroughly wiped down your door with the solution, rinse it off with clean water before drying the door down thoroughly with a soft rag. After this, your steel entry door should be as clean as can be.
